  • Patent number: 11845003
    Abstract: Provided is a golf game that is readily intuitively playable by a user. An input reception section receives an operation input indicating a motion of an input device gripped by the hands of the user. A control section controls a motion of a player character in a game space in accordance with the operation input. An image generation section generates a game image. When a golf club held by the player character comes into contact with the ground in the game space, the control section drives a stimulus generation section disposed in the input device to stimulate the user's hands gripping the input device.
